(Image: PNW Disease Handbook)<\/figcaption>\n    <\/figure>\n<p>Two problems common to many fruiting and ornamental <em>Prunus<\/em> species are bacterial flower blight which often progresses into bacterial canker, and brown rot blossom blight and fruit rot.<\/p>\n<p>Both diseases begin with very similar signs and symptoms. Flowers brown earlier than normal and collapse; the infection sometimes continues onto the attached twigs, where the affected leaves dry and cling to the branch; then, too, gumming or ooze may appear. Both diseases may kill branches, eventually the tree.<\/p>\n<p>So, if you\u2019ve been stumped now and then as to the correct diagnosis\u2014brown rot versus bacterial blight \u2013 be heartened by the words of Jay Pscheidt, co-author of the PNW Disease Management Handbook: \u201cSymptoms of the two will initially look the same. The big difference will be the development of signs \u2013 brown rot spores that give it that dull sort of gray coloration. So, if it has spores, it is for sure brown rot but, if they do not develop, we can\u2019t really say for sure which it might be.\u201d (Ed. comment: Ugh.)<\/p>\n<p><strong>A diagnostic option <\/strong><\/p>\n<p>As you know, MGs begin by obtaining a thorough history from clients. But, before submitting any sample from your MG Office, consult with one of the following persons: for Clackamas County: Jane Collier; for Multnomah and Washington Counties: Jean Natter.<\/p>\n<p><strong>Factors in both diseases<\/strong><\/p>\n<p>&#8211; Cold wet weather for Bacterial Blight; warm moist weather for Brown Rot. (This spring was perfect for brown rot.)<\/p>\n<p>&#8211; Stressed trees are more susceptible.<\/p>\n<p>&#8211; Some cultivars have tolerance while others are very susceptible<\/p>\n<figure id=\"attachment_1728\" class=\"wp-caption thumbnail alignleft\" style=\"width: 464px;\">\n    <a href=\"http:\/\/blogs.oregonstate.edu\/mgmetro\/files\/2019\/05\/fig2-peach-brown-rot-3Natter-2011-09.jpg\"><img loading=\"lazy\" decoding=\"async\" class=\" wp-image-1728\" src=\"http:\/\/blogs.oregonstate.edu\/mgmetro\/files\/2019\/05\/fig2-peach-brown-rot-3Natter-2011-09-300x225.jpg\" alt=\"\" width=\"464\" height=\"348\" srcset=\"https:\/\/osu-wams-blogs-uploads.s3.amazonaws.com\/blogs.dir\/2080\/files\/2019\/05\/fig2-peach-brown-rot-3Natter-2011-09-300x225.jpg 300w, https:\/\/osu-wams-blogs-uploads.s3.amazonaws.com\/blogs.dir\/2080\/files\/2019\/05\/fig2-peach-brown-rot-3Natter-2011-09-768x576.jpg 768w, https:\/\/osu-wams-blogs-uploads.s3.amazonaws.com\/blogs.dir\/2080\/files\/2019\/05\/fig2-peach-brown-rot-3Natter-2011-09-1024x768.jpg 1024w, https:\/\/osu-wams-blogs-uploads.s3.amazonaws.com\/blogs.dir\/2080\/files\/2019\/05\/fig2-peach-brown-rot-3Natter-2011-09-1250x938.jpg 1250w, https:\/\/osu-wams-blogs-uploads.s3.amazonaws.com\/blogs.dir\/2080\/files\/2019\/05\/fig2-peach-brown-rot-3Natter-2011-09-400x300.jpg 400w, https:\/\/osu-wams-blogs-uploads.s3.amazonaws.com\/blogs.dir\/2080\/files\/2019\/05\/fig2-peach-brown-rot-3Natter-2011-09.jpg 2048w\" sizes=\"auto, (max-width: 464px) 100vw, 464px\" \/><\/a>\n    <figcaption class=\"wp-caption-text\">Fig 2:<br \/>A verification of brown rot may have to wait until signs of fungal sporulation appear on affected tissues, among them fruits.
